Hyderabad: BRS working president K.T. Rama Rao on Tuesday called for a state-wide student agitation, accusing the Congress government of damaging Telangana’s education system. He said the ruling party had failed to fulfil its promises on fee reimbursement and BC reservations.
While addressing student wing leaders at his residence, KTR alleged that the Congress regime has undone the progress achieved under former Chief Minister K. Chandrashekar Rao. According to him, this progress stemmed from the expansion of Gurukul institutions and residential colleges. Furthermore, he criticised the Congress for spreading “Goebbels-style propaganda” to undermine a decade of educational reforms.
KTR presses for fee reimbursement and better Gurukul conditions
KTR announced that the BRS will intensify protests from next month. Therefore, he urged student leaders to mobilise in all Assembly constituencies. The core demand, he emphasised, is the immediate release of pending fee reimbursement funds. In addition, he highlighted the poor conditions in Gurukul institutions, citing low food standards and recent student suicides as critical concerns. As a result, he called for targeted agitation to draw attention to these issues.
Moreover, KTR encouraged students to actively use social media to expose what he described as the Congress government’s “betrayal” on education, employment, and reservation policies. He also reminded the ruling party of its commitment to provide 42% BC reservation in education and jobs — a pledge he claimed remains unfulfilled.
Students urged to mark Deeksha Diwas on November 29
Looking ahead, KTR urged all universities and colleges to observe November 29 as “Deeksha Diwas.” The date marks the anniversary of KCR’s hunger strike, which intensified the Telangana statehood movement. Accordingly, he asked educational institutions to commemorate student martyrs and raise awareness among young citizens.
“Real leaders are born from movements,” he stated. In conclusion, he called on students to resist what he described as the Congress party’s anarchy and to fight for the future of Telangana.
